Software Engineer Manager, Search UI Infrastructure, Design System

Google is a global technology leader specializing in internet-related services and products.
Frontend
Staff Software Engineer
In-Person
5,000+ Employees
8+ years of experience
Enterprise SaaS

Description For Software Engineer Manager, Search UI Infrastructure, Design System

Google Search is undergoing a transformation to reimagine how information search works across all platforms. As a Software Engineering Manager for the Search UI Infrastructure team, you'll lead a skilled engineering team focused on building the next generation of search rendering infrastructure. This role combines technical leadership with team management, overseeing critical infrastructure initiatives that power Google Search's core rendering stack. You'll work with cross-functional teams to deliver flexible, scalable, and high-performance platforms, directly impacting billions of users worldwide. The position requires expertise in web technologies, performance optimization, and team leadership. You'll be responsible for managing multiple teams and locations, overseeing large-scale project deployments, and contributing to product strategy while ensuring technical excellence. This role offers a unique opportunity to shape how Search works and influence how feature developers across Google bring their ideas to users, while maintaining Google's commitment to universal accessibility and usefulness.

Last updated 2 months ago

Responsibilities For Software Engineer Manager, Search UI Infrastructure, Design System

  • Lead and mentor a team of engineers, focusing on fostering growth, collaboration, and technical excellence
  • Partner with Search feature teams and other infrastructure groups to ensure solutions meet business needs
  • Manage complex projects from inception through execution
  • Ensure the team's deliverables align with organizational goals related to infrastructure scalability, reliability, and maintainability
  • Architect solid/stable/maintainable software systems with clean APIs

Requirements For Software Engineer Manager, Search UI Infrastructure, Design System

React
JavaScript
TypeScript
Java
Python
  • Bachelor's degree in Computer Science, a related technical field, or equivalent practical experience
  • 8 years of experience with software development in one or more programming languages, and with data structures/algorithms
  • 5 years of experience in launching software products, testing and 3 years of experience with software design and architecture
  • Experience with Web technologies, libraries and frameworks like React or Vue, and programming languages like Java, Javascript/Typescript
  • Experience using Python libraries and frameworks
  • Ability to communicate in English fluently to collaborate with stakeholders

Interested in this job?

Jobs Related To Google Software Engineer Manager, Search UI Infrastructure, Design System

Staff Software Developer, Glasses Systems UI

Staff Software Developer position at Google, focusing on AR/VR interfaces and AI-driven systems for next-generation wearable devices.

Staff Interaction Designer

Staff Interaction Designer position at Google Ads, focusing on creating user-centered design solutions for advertising products with 8+ years of experience required.

Senior UX Design Manager, Shopping

Lead UX design teams at Google Shopping, driving innovation and user-centered design solutions while managing and developing design talent across global locations.

Senior Staff Designer, UI and Formats, Search Ads

Senior Staff Designer position at Google focusing on UI and Formats for Search Ads, combining visual design expertise with user experience leadership.

Staff UX Designer, Buyflows, Payments Platform

Staff UX Designer position at Google focusing on Payments Platform, requiring 8+ years of experience in product design/UX, offering competitive compensation and benefits.